[Bug 330811] Re: Can't connect to a hidden network

2009-06-21 Thread Scott Testerman
Verifying that the new release does now work for WPA1/TKIP hidden
networks.  I'll test others as I run across them.

For those who cannot get it to work, it may be worth noting that the fix did 
NOT work for me until I 
1) went into the plasmoid's Manage Connections screen, on the Wireless tab, and 
deleted ALL instances of the hidden network,
2) disabled wireless, 
3) logged out and back in, and finally 
4) attempted to connect as normal (using the new Connect to hidden network 
button -- hooray!).

It's worked flawlessly since, and the negotiation speed seems to be just
a tiny bit faster than before.

[Bug 390155] [NEW] Inconsistent server IP: 192.168.0.[1-or-254]

2009-06-21 Thread Alkis Georgopoulos
Public bug reported:

While installing from the Jaunty alternate CD, the server internal NIC is 
assigned a static IP of 192.168.0.254 in /etc/network/interfaces.
But /etc/ltsp/dhcpd.conf assumes an IP of 192.168.0.1.
This difference is also present in some of the ltsp scripts.
This makes it impossible to do NATting on the server for the clients to 
directly access the Internet (e.g. for the TIMESERVER lts.conf directive to 
work, of for localapps-firefox to work), unless one of those two files are 
manually modified.

[Bug 318249] Re: does not handle updated file images with changed md5sums

2009-06-21 Thread charles
When upstream ticket http://trac.transmissionbt.com/ticket/2228 was
filed yesterday with the summary transmission should learn to truncate
files on updating torrents it reminded me of this ticket.  IMO #2228's
summary describes what's happening here.

What's happening is that when the updated iso is smaller than the
earlier version, Transmission wasn't truncating the file, so the file
checksum fails.  However, the BitTorrent *piece* checksums are still
correct, so you were *not* sharing bad data to the rest of the world.

At any rate, since upstream #2228 spelled out what was going on and how
to fix it, this is fixed in upstream svn trunk in
http://trac.transmissionbt.com/changeset/8726 for 1.73.

[Bug 384344] Re: [3G] NetworkManager does not detect ZTE AC8710 CDMA/EVDO 3G USB Modem

2009-06-21 Thread Tim Cole
Ive noticed that your device shows 4 ttys and i will assume that ttyUSB0
is the cdma modem since you say you can connect with wvdial on that tty.

These are the steps I followed to get my modem recognized by
NetworkManager.

The clue here is the line that says:
Jun 6 23:06:13 xxx NetworkManager: info (ttyUSB0): found serial port (udev: 
hal:CDMA)

In a working configuration I would expect it to say:
Jun 6 23:06:13 xxx NetworkManager: info (ttyUSB0): found serial port 
(udev:CDMA hal:CDMA) I'm guessing.

When you plug in your device, there are some udev rules that get run.
One of the rules that gets run, probes the modem to determine its capabilities. 
If this probe does not execute correctly, NM will not know that it can use your 
device.

The program that probes is /lib/udev/nm-modem-probe.

You can run this standalone to check that you modem is probed correctly.
try /lib/udev/nm-modem-probe --verbose --export /dev/ttyUSB0

You show get a bunch of output and ultimatleey two lines that read something 
like,
ID_NM_PROBED=1
ID_NM_CDMA=1 (just guessing here, mine is GSM).

Once you know the modem is being probed correctly, check that the rules are 
configured correctly.
In jaunty the live in
/lib/udev/rules.d/77-nm-probe-modem-capabilities.rules

for testing you could use something like

ACTION!=add|change, GOTO=nm_modem_probe_end
SUBSYSTEM!=tty, GOTO=nm_modem_probe_end
KERNEL!=tty*, GOTO=nm_modem_probe_end

SUBSYSTEM==tty, SUBSYSTEMS==usb, DRIVERS==?*, 
ENV{NM_MODEM_DRIVER}=$attr{driver}
SUBSYSTEM==tty, SUBSYSTEMS==usb, ATTRS{bInterfaceNumber}==?*, 
ENV{NM_MODEM_USB_INTERFACE_NUMBER}=$attr{bInterfaceNumber}
SUBSYSTEM==tty, SUBSYSTEMS==usb, ATTRS{idVendor}==?*, 
ATTRS{idProduct}==?*, IMPORT{program}=nm-modem-probe --vid 0x$attr{idVendor} 
--pid 0x$attr{idProduct} --usb-interface $env{NM_MODEM_USB_INTERFACE_NUMBER} 
--driver $env{NM_MODEM_DRIVER} --delay 3000 --export $tempnode, 
GOTO=nm_modem_probe_end

LABEL=nm_modem_probe_end

If this does not work, please attach the verbose output of nm-modem-probe.
Also attach the ouput of udevadm query all on the /sys/class/tty/ttyUSB0 path.
